Single Discount Question 2:

A shopkeeper offers a festive offer: buy any three shirts, get two free. Find the equivalent percentage discount for the offer.

  1. 30%
  2. 60%
  3. 20%
  4. 40%

Answer (Detailed Solution Below)

Option 4 : 40%

Single Discount Question 2 Detailed Solution

Given:

A shopkeeper offers a festive offer: buy any three shirts, get two free.

Formula used:

Equivalent Discount Percentage = Number of Free Items/Total Items (Paid + Free) × 100

Calculation:

Total shirts = 3 (paid) + 2 (free) = 5

Equivalent Discount Percentage = 2/5 × 100

⇒ Equivalent Discount Percentage = (2 × 100) / 5

⇒ Equivalent Discount Percentage = 200 / 5

⇒ Equivalent Discount Percentage = 40%

∴ The correct answer is option (4).

Single Discount Question 3:

An article is at 10% more than the CP. If discount of 10% is allowed then which of the following is right ?

  1. 1% gain
  2. 1% loss
  3. no gain no loss
  4. More than one of the above
  5. None of the above

Answer (Detailed Solution Below)

Option 2 : 1% loss

Single Discount Question 3 Detailed Solution

Given:

Marked price is 10% more than the cost price (CP).

Discount of 10% is allowed.

Formula used:

Marked price (MP) = CP + 10% of CP

Selling price (SP) = MP - 10% of MP

Profit/Loss = SP - CP

Profit/Loss % = (Profit/Loss / CP) × 100

Calculation:

Let the cost price (CP) be 100.

Marked price (MP) = 100 + 10% of 100 = 100 + 10 = 110.

Discount = 10% of 110 = 11.

Selling price (SP) = 110 - 11 = 99.

Profit/Loss = SP - CP = 99 - 100 = -1.

Loss = 1.

Loss % = (1 / 100) × 100 = 1%.

∴ There is a loss of 1%.
